About The Position

As an Escrow Assistant, you will play a pivotal role in supporting the Escrow Officer to ensure smooth and efficient transactions. Your responsibilities including the following: Administrative Support: Assist Escrow Officer in preparing and organizing escrow files, receipt contracts/earnest money, open orders, order home warranties, order HOA documents, etc Clearing of Title: Ability to read a title commitment, assist with any curative required to clear Schedule C including ordering payoffs, callings applicable parties, ordering and coordinating releases Preparing CD/HUD: Ability to prepare preliminary CD/HUD and balance with lender Schedule Management: Coordinate scheduling of closings and/or mobile notaries Closing/Funding: Prepare title closing documents, send for funding, assist with balancing files and disbursement of funds including preparing outgoing wires and checks, record applicable documents, ability to package lender packages and other post-closing responsibilities Customer Service: Be a primary point of contact for clients and real estate agents via email and phone, handling a significant portion of communications with professionalism and courtesy
